TY - JOUR TI - SUSTAINABILITY AND TAILINGS MANAGEMENT IN THE MINING INDUSTRY: PASTE TECHNOLOGY AB - In this study, the basic principles of paste technology which has been implemented successfully in the mining industry forboth waste volume reduction and environmental impact reduction were investigated. In the past two decades, pastetechnology has progressed from a research-based mine backfill idea to a widely accepted and cost-effective fill system withthe potential to totally change the approach tailings are disposed on the surface. Application of paste tailings for modernmines was shown experimentally by laboratory and field testing, focusing on intrinsic (e.g., tailings, cement and mix waterproperties) and extrinsic (e.g., in situ mixing, placement and curing conditions) parameters. Results indicate that use ofpaste tailings as backfilling and disposal in the mining industry as an innovative and environmentally sound system canguarantee operational continuity by reducing environmental (e.g., tailings dam failure, acidic water formation) andfinancial concerns over the mine’s life. Finally, paste technology enables mining operators to better manage theirproblematic tailings produced in the mineral processing plants.
